HP G71t-300 Cooling Fan Replacement

    • Ground yourself by either touching an unpainted metal surface or by using the Anti-Static wrist strap.

    • Turn off the computer and remove the charger from the charging port.

    • Turn the laptop over and slide the battery release catch to the right. The battery will pop up from its slot. Remove it using your fingers.

    • Use a Phillips #0 screwdriver to remove the four screws from the indicated cover.

    • Gently lift and remove the cover.

    • Remove the five 6mm screws with the Phillips #0 screwdriver.

    • Pry the keyboard off with a spudger. Be careful not to apply too much pressure and damage any components.

    • Disconnect the clip attaching the keyboard wiring to the motherboard. Lift and remove the keyboard.

    • Use a Phillips #0 screwdriver to remove the 6mm screw from the top panel.

    • Gently lift and remove the panel. Use a metal spudger if the it seems set in place.

    • Use a Phillips #0 screwdriver to remove the 6mm screw for the Wi-Fi module cover.

    • Remove the cover.

    • Remove all fourteen 6mm screws using a Phillips #0 screwdriver.

    • Partially separate the two panels until connectors are visible.

    • Unclip the wires that attach the trackpad module to the motherboard.

    • Remove the five highlighted screws using a Phillips #0 screwdriver.

    • Disconnect the five cables by gently pulling them from their slots.

    • Press a metal spudger between the VGA port and the plastic housing to pry up the motherboard.

    • Remove the motherboard and turn it so that the fan is facing upward.

    • Use a Phillips #0 screwdriver to loosen the three screws attaching the heatsink to the motherboard.

    • Remove the heatsink and fan assembly by unclipping the fan from the motherboard.

Abschluss

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
